OBITUARY
June Gayle Coggins
1 July, 1937 – 23 May, 2020
IN THE CARE OF
Rosewood-Kellum Funeral Home & Rosewood Memorial Park
Our beloved mother, grandmother, aunt and friend, June Gayle Coggins, 82, passed away in Virginia Beach, Virginia on May 23, 2020. June was born on July 1, 1937 in Norfolk, Virginia. She is preceded in death by her loving companion of 10 years, Ralph Redford; parents, Joseph and Mary Foster (McKnown), four sisters, Mildred, Miriam, Rosalee and Joann. She is survived by her sons, William Gleason, (Bill) Gary Gleason (Barbara) and Stephen Gleason; daughter, Linda Gavoni; (Tim), granddaughters Kristin, Patricia, Brittany and Jessica, grandson, Steve, great granddaughter, Megan and great grandson, Shawn, a very special nephew, Terry Maness (Gina) and her beloved dog Peanut along with many nieces and nephews.
June loved to dance and loved being around her family. She was a care giver to many people over the years and always loved giving to others. She will be truly missed by so many.
